Transaction 13e59e15152ddbde397e64736d4b75dfb0b5e33ba92f1db91ad40fee66349491
1 Input
2 Outputs
- 13e59e15152ddbde397e64736d4b75dfb0b5e33ba92f1db91ad40fee66349491:0
- 13e59e15152ddbde397e64736d4b75dfb0b5e33ba92f1db91ad40fee66349491:1
value 1346271
address 1Puthn7n9J1L3r4o9EMzmVWPHx1ZjPtouc
value 1023540
address 19WLCMYPyBKXYJcaaptju564cRBUnfy2Xo